What is a Condenser Air Conditioner and How Does It Work?

A condenser air conditioner is a type of cooling system that uses a condenser unit to remove heat from a designated area, typically indoors, and expel it outside. This system is a key component of central air conditioning systems and is responsible for cooling the refrigerant, which then circulates through the indoor evaporator coil to cool the air in the living space.

According to the U.S. Department of Energy, air conditioning systems are critical for maintaining comfort in homes and buildings, particularly in hotter climates where outdoor temperatures can rise significantly. The condenser unit works by compressing refrigerant gas, which then releases heat as it transitions from gas to liquid form, ultimately leading to a cooler indoor environment.

Key aspects of a condenser air conditioner include the refrigeration cycle, which consists of four main processes: compression, condensation, expansion, and evaporation. The compressor compresses the refrigerant, causing it to heat up and move to the condenser coil, where it releases heat to the outside air. This process is crucial for efficient cooling, making the selection of the best condenser air conditioner vital for energy efficiency and performance.

This impacts energy consumption and utility bills, as an efficient condenser can significantly reduce the amount of electricity required to maintain a comfortable indoor climate. Additionally, the effectiveness of a condenser air conditioner can enhance indoor air quality by controlling humidity levels and preventing mold growth.

The benefits of using a high-quality condenser air conditioner include improved energy efficiency, which can lead to lower monthly energy costs. According to Energy Star, air conditioners that are certified can be up to 15% more efficient than standard models, which can result in savings over time. Furthermore, a well-maintained condenser unit can have a longer lifespan and require fewer repairs.

Best practices for maximizing the efficiency of a condenser air conditioner include regular maintenance, such as cleaning the condenser coils, ensuring proper airflow, and scheduling annual professional inspections. Additionally, investing in a unit with a higher Seasonal Energy Efficiency Ratio (SEER) rating can also contribute to better energy efficiency and performance, ultimately leading to a more comfortable living environment.

What Features Should You Look for When Choosing the Best Condenser Air Conditioner?

When choosing the best condenser air conditioner, consider the following features:

  • Energy Efficiency Ratio (EER): A higher EER indicates better energy efficiency, meaning lower electricity bills. Look for units with an EER rating of 12 or higher to ensure you are getting a unit that balances performance with energy consumption.
  • Cooling Capacity: Measured in BTUs (British Thermal Units), the cooling capacity determines how well the air conditioner can cool a space. Choose a unit with an appropriate BTU rating for the size of the room to ensure effective cooling without overworking the system.
  • Noise Level: The noise level of the condenser air conditioner is crucial for comfort, especially in residential settings. Look for models that operate at 50 decibels or lower for quieter performance, making them suitable for bedrooms and living areas.
  • Durability and Build Quality: A well-built unit made from high-quality materials will last longer and require less maintenance. Check for features like corrosion-resistant coatings and robust construction that can withstand various environmental conditions.
  • Warranty and Customer Support: A good warranty reflects the manufacturer’s confidence in their product and provides peace of mind for the buyer. Look for models that offer at least a 5-year warranty on parts and good customer support options for assistance in case of issues.
  • Smart Features: Modern air conditioners often come with smart technology that allows for remote operation via apps or voice control. These features enhance convenience and can help optimize energy use by allowing you to set schedules or adjust temperatures from anywhere.
  • Installation Requirements: Consider the complexity of installation and whether you need professional help or can install it yourself. Some units are designed for easy installation while others may have specific requirements that could increase overall costs.

What Are the Benefits of Using a High-Efficiency Condenser Air Conditioner?

The benefits of using a high-efficiency condenser air conditioner are numerous and can significantly enhance comfort and savings.

  • Energy Savings: High-efficiency condenser air conditioners are designed to consume less energy while providing the same cooling power as standard units. This reduced energy consumption translates into lower utility bills, making them a cost-effective option over time.
  • Environmental Impact: By using less energy, these air conditioners contribute to a decrease in greenhouse gas emissions. Choosing a high-efficiency model helps homeowners minimize their carbon footprint and support sustainable practices.
  • Improved Comfort: These systems often provide more consistent cooling and better humidity control compared to less efficient models. This results in a more comfortable indoor environment, especially during extreme weather conditions.
  • Longer Lifespan: High-efficiency units typically have advanced technology and materials that contribute to their durability. As a result, they often have a longer lifespan than standard air conditioners, reducing the frequency of replacements and repairs.
  • Quieter Operation: Many high-efficiency air conditioners are designed to operate more quietly than traditional models. This feature enhances the overall comfort of the living space, making it more enjoyable without the disruptive noise associated with older systems.
  • Advanced Features: High-efficiency models often come equipped with modern technology, such as smart thermostats and variable-speed motors. These features allow for better temperature control and energy management, offering convenience and efficiency for homeowners.

What Factors Can Affect the Efficiency of Your Condenser Air Conditioner?

Several factors can significantly influence the efficiency of your condenser air conditioner:

  • Ambient Temperature: The temperature of the air surrounding your condenser unit can impact its performance. Higher outdoor temperatures can cause the unit to work harder to cool your home, reducing its efficiency and leading to increased energy consumption.
  • Condenser Coil Condition: The cleanliness of the condenser coils is crucial for optimal efficiency. Dust, dirt, and debris can accumulate on the coils, hindering heat exchange and ultimately forcing the unit to operate inefficiently, which can lead to higher utility bills and potential breakdowns.
  • Refrigerant Levels: The amount of refrigerant in your air conditioning system affects its ability to cool effectively. Low refrigerant levels, often caused by leaks, can lead to reduced cooling capacity and increased energy usage, while overcharging can also create inefficiencies.
  • Airflow Restrictions: Proper airflow is essential for maximizing the efficiency of your air conditioner. Blocked or obstructed ducts, dirty air filters, or improperly sized return vents can restrict airflow, forcing the unit to work harder and leading to energy wastage.
  • Thermostat Settings: The settings on your thermostat play a vital role in the efficiency of your air conditioning system. If the thermostat is set too low, the unit will run continuously, which can lead to increased energy use; conversely, setting it at a higher temperature during peak times can save energy.
  • Insulation Quality: The quality of insulation in your home can impact the workload of your air conditioner. Poor insulation allows cool air to escape and warm air to enter, making the unit work harder to maintain the desired temperature, thus reducing overall efficiency.
  • Unit Size: The size of the condenser air conditioner relative to the space it cools is critical. An undersized unit will struggle to cool the area, while an oversized unit will cycle on and off too frequently, both scenarios leading to inefficiencies and increased wear on the system.
  • Maintenance Frequency: Regular maintenance is essential to keep your air conditioning system running efficiently. Neglecting routine checks, cleaning, and servicing can lead to performance issues and reduced efficiency over time, as small problems can escalate into larger, costlier repairs.
